Severe thunderstorms hit the area on Wednesday, causing power outages. CenterPoint Energy made progress in restoring electricity overnight, with nearly 6,000 customers regaining power.

However, many residents were still without electricity on Thursday morning. Approximately 5,000 customers remained affected as crews worked to complete repairs.
